Angled Faceplate Adapters suit network cabling outlets.

Press Release Summary:



Available in 1- and 2-port models, TERA®-MAX® Adapters provide angled work area mounting solution for TERA and flat UTP MAX outlets within CT faceplates. By orienting outlets at angle, adapters cut mounting depth requirements by half. This helps to overcome installation challenges when mounting category 7A TERA outlets into shallow back boxes and minimizes cable bend radius requirement for larger diameter, category 7A shielded cables.

Siemon Announces New Angled Faceplate Adapter for Network Cabling Outlets



WATERTOWN, Conn., March 30 /-- Siemon, a global leader in network cabling, launches the new TERA(R)-MAX(R) angled faceplate adapter. These new CT faceplate adapters provide an angled work area mounting solution for Siemon's TERA and flat UTP MAX outlets within CT faceplates.

By orienting the outlets at an angle, angled faceplate adapters reduce mounting depth requirements for work area outlets by as much as 50%. This depth reduction helps overcome installation challenges when mounting category 7A TERA outlets into shallow back boxes while reducing the cable bend radius requirement for larger diameter, higher performing category 7A shielded cables. These new 1 and 2 port adapters snap securely into any Siemon CT(R) faceplate. CT faceplates are available in a wide variety of standard international configurations, including single and double-gang options capable of supporting 4 TERA-MAX adapters and 8 outlets. CT horizontal faceplates, modular furniture adapters, service fitting plates and surface-mounting options are also available.
